
Nuno Carvalho contributed to the percona/percona-server repository, focusing on enhancing replication reliability and performance in C++ and SQL environments. Over five months, he addressed complex concurrency and replication issues, such as race conditions in transaction ordering and latency spikes during group membership changes, by introducing synchronization mechanisms and timeout-based guards. Nuno improved build compatibility with OpenSSL, strengthened failover validation, and stabilized test automation, demonstrating deep knowledge of database internals and distributed systems. His work included refactoring for memory safety and robust error handling, resulting in more stable CI pipelines and safer production deployments, reflecting a thorough and methodical engineering approach.

June 2025 performance summary for percona/percona-server focused on reliability and safety improvements in critical replication components. Key outcomes include stabilizing flaky tests and hardening GTID wait validation, contributing to more stable CI and safer production behavior.
June 2025 performance summary for percona/percona-server focused on reliability and safety improvements in critical replication components. Key outcomes include stabilizing flaky tests and hardening GTID wait validation, contributing to more stable CI and safer production behavior.
May 2025 monthly summary for percona/percona-server focusing on performance and reliability improvements in Group Replication.
May 2025 monthly summary for percona/percona-server focusing on performance and reliability improvements in Group Replication.
Concise monthly summary for 2025-03 focusing on percona-server. Delivered a targeted fix for Group Replication to prevent certifier interference and enable proper garbage collection, stabilizing transaction row counts and improving replication reliability across multi-node deployments.
Concise monthly summary for 2025-03 focusing on percona-server. Delivered a targeted fix for Group Replication to prevent certifier interference and enable proper garbage collection, stabilizing transaction row counts and improving replication reliability across multi-node deployments.
February 2025: Delivered stability, compatibility, and performance improvements for Percona Server (percona/percona-server). Key work included implementing a build-fix for OpenSSL 1.1+ compatibility, enabling concurrent processing of empty transactions in Group Replication to boost throughput, and hardening asynchronous connection failover validation to prevent crashes and invalid inputs. These changes reduce customer build issues, improve replication efficiency, and strengthen failover resilience. The work demonstrates proactive quality assurance, backport discipline, and a strong focus on reliability and performance.
February 2025: Delivered stability, compatibility, and performance improvements for Percona Server (percona/percona-server). Key work included implementing a build-fix for OpenSSL 1.1+ compatibility, enabling concurrent processing of empty transactions in Group Replication to boost throughput, and hardening asynchronous connection failover validation to prevent crashes and invalid inputs. These changes reduce customer build issues, improve replication efficiency, and strengthen failover resilience. The work demonstrates proactive quality assurance, backport discipline, and a strong focus on reliability and performance.
Month 2024-10 — concise monthly summary focusing on the key accomplishments.
Month 2024-10 — concise monthly summary focusing on the key accomplishments.
Overview of all repositories you've contributed to across your timeline